为超过 100 万开发者提供专业的 API 服务,所有 API 均提供免费的服务

天气预报查询API:获取实时、预报天气数据

在数字化时代,天气数据已成为我们日常生活中不可或缺的一部分。无论是出行规划、户外活动安排,还是农业生产、能源管理,准确及时的天气信息都扮演着至关重要的角色。而天气预报查询API(应用程序接口)作为连接数据与应用的桥梁,为我们提供了一种高效、便捷的方式来获取实时和预报天气数据。

引言

在数字化时代,天气数据已成为我们日常生活中不可或缺的一部分。无论是出行规划、户外活动安排,还是农业生产、能源管理,准确及时的天气信息都扮演着至关重要的角色。而天气预报查询API(应用程序接口)作为连接数据与应用的桥梁,为我们提供了一种高效、便捷的方式来获取实时和预报天气数据。

天气预报查询 API 的技术基础

  1. 数据来源: 天气预报API通常依赖于气象站、卫星、雷达等收集的实时数据。这些数据经过气象模型的分析和处理,形成预报结果。
  2. 数据处理: 气象数据的处理涉及到复杂的算法和模型,包括数值天气预报、统计预报等方法。这些技术确保了预报的准确性和可靠性。
  3. API 架构: 天气预报API通常采用RESTful架构,通过HTTP协议提供服务。开发者可以通过简单的HTTP请求获取JSON或XML格式的天气数据。

天气预报查询 API

APISpace天气预报查询,支持全国以及全球多个城市的天气查询,包含国内3400+个城市以及国际4万个城市的实况数据,同时也支持全球任意经纬度查询,接口会返回该经纬度最近的站点信息;更新频率分钟级别。

天气预报查询API

天气实况接口返回示例:

{
    "status": 0,
    "result": {
        "location": {
            "areacode": "JPN10041001001",        //城市ID
            "name": "足立区",                    //城市中文名
            "country": "日本",                    //所属国家中文名
            "path": "足立区,足立区,东京都,日本"    //行政区划路径
        },
        "realtime": {
            "text": "多云",                //天气现象,string类型
            "code": "01",                        //天气现象编码,string类型
            "temp": 6.5,                        //气温,单位℃,double类型
            "feels_like": 6,                //体感温度,单位℃,int类型
            "rh": 38,                        //相对湿度,单位%,int类型
            "wind_class": "2级",                //蒲福氏风级,string类型
            "wind_speed": 2.5,        //风速,单位m/s,double类型
            "wind_dir": "南风",                //风向,string类型
            "wind_angle": 187,        //风向角度,0表示正北,180表示正南,int类型
            "prec": 0.0,                        //过去1小时降水量,单位毫米(mm),double类型
            "prec_time": "2021-03-05 18:00:00", //过去1小时降水量所对应的时间段
            "clouds": 99,                //云量,单位%,int类型
            "vis": 12085,                //能见度,单位米(m),int类型
            "pressure": 1020,                //气压,单位百帕(hPa),int类型
            "dew": -6,                        //露点温度,单位℃,int类型
            "uv": 2,                        //紫外线指数,int类型
            "snow": 0.0,                //降雪量,单位厘米(cm),double类型 #国内城市不支持#
            "weight": 0,                //文案权重,int类型
            "brief": "今日惊蛰",                //天气短文案,string类型
            "detail": "今日惊蛰,春雷惊百虫",                //天气长文案 ,string类型
        },
        "last_update": "2021-03-05 19:07:44"        //数据更新时间(北京时间)
    }
}

天气预报查询API的应用场景

  1. 个人使用: 个人用户可以通过智能手机应用、网站等渠道,查询所在地的天气情况,规划日常活动。
  2. 企业应用: 物流、农业、航空等行业需要精确的天气信息来优化运营。例如,航空公司可以根据天气预报调整航班计划,减少延误。
  3. 公共安全: 政府和应急部门利用天气预报API监测极端天气事件,提前发布预警,保护人民生命财产安全。

结语

天气预报查询API不仅极大地方便了我们的日常生活,也为各行各业提供了重要的决策支持。随着技术的不断进步,我们可以预见,天气预报API将在未来发挥更加关键的作用,为人类社会带来更多的便利和安全。

Last Updated on 2024-12-13 by admin